    Posted by Nathan on June 12, 2006 at 4:16 pm

    I cannot for the life of me get a RAM preview of my whole animation. I am using AE 7, the clip is 2 minutes long. It seems to always only do a chunk of the animation. Checked the help files and found nothing on how to preview the entire animation.

    Any help?

    If it is necessary laptop specs are. Dell Inspiron, 2.3 ghz, 1gb RAM, 60gb HDD, NVIDIA Go7800 vid card.

  • Colin Braley

    June 12, 2006 at 4:31 pm

    AE is not like Premiere or Final Cut where you can just preview your whole timeline. To get a whole 7 min comp to RAM Preview your gonna need a LOT more RAM. Try opening up your comp settings and lowering the resolution to preview a longer duration.
    ~Colin

  • Steve Roberts

    June 12, 2006 at 5:52 pm

    Don’t forget edit>purge image caches every now and then.

  • Mylenium

    June 12, 2006 at 7:17 pm

    Umm, guess why it’s called RAM preview? 1 Gig levels out to about 45 secs of preview time at full resolution at best. Lower your comp resolution to half or quarter and try it again. Since AE will calculate less pixels per frame, many more frames fit into your RAM and thus you may be able to preview much larger chunks (not necessarily your entire timeline).

  • Al

    June 13, 2006 at 3:27 pm

    you can also try ‘skip frames’ in the RAM preview box, this will give you more run for your money… though obviously you’re not getting the whole deal
